FunnelStory | Principal Engineer, AI Systems | Remote (India) | Full-Time | funnelstory.ai FunnelStory builds a queryable context graph over enterprise data — the infrastructure layer that lets AI agents reason over live customer intelligence. We've built a federated query engine purpose-built for agents, ML models from scratch in Go (health scoring, cohort expansion, process mining, Markov chains, Genetic Pareto optimization), and on-prem deployment infrastructure for enterprise customers. All on a deterministically tested backend. We need engineers who go deep. The kind who read academic papers to build something novel, then hunt down a performance bottleneck five layers deep in the stack. Go is preferred but not required. Strong math and systems engineering background is a plus. What's required: ability to solve hard problems, use AI tooling to add real value (not slop), and drive work forward independently.
